trumpeting


Meanings
  • Verb

    The act of making a loud, continuous sound with a trumpet.

    - "The soldiers trumpeted to signal the start of the battle."
    - "The trumpeter played a fanfare to announce the arrival of the king."
  • Noun

    A loud, continuous sound made by a trumpet.

    - "The sound of the trumpets woke the villagers."
    - "The funeral procession was accompanied by the mournful sound of trumpets."

Etymology
origin and the way in which meanings have changed throughout history.

From Old French trompeter, from trompe, trumpet.

Culture
Any cultural, historical, or symbolic significance of the word. Explore how the word has been used in literature, art, music, or other forms of expression.

Trumpeting has been used in various cultural contexts, such as military signaling, fanfares, and funerals. In literature, trumpeting is often used metaphorically to describe a loud, boastful announcement or declaration.
